Lubrizol Advanced Materials, Inc., a subsidiary of The Lubrizol Corporation announced that its Solsperse 72700 polymeric dispersant, provides higher productivity in many solvent-based packaging ink applications due to its high millbase loading and shorter dispersion times.
Solsperse 72700 dispersant is a 40% active polymeric dispersant in ethyl acetate, recommended for use with organic pigments-including blues, rubines and specific grades of yellow-and carbon black in alcohol-rich systems. It is suitable for resin-free and resin-containing dispersions that are compatible with a variety of key binder resins, including nitrocellulose, polyurethane and polyamide. In these applications, the company claims that Solsperse 72700 dispersant produces highly pigmented concentrates, making it ideal for mixing schemes. In addition, it provides high tinctorial properties-especially when applied to carbon black pigments-and also improves the performance of poor wetting resins. Solsperse 72700 should be dissolved in the millbase resin or solvent before the addition of pigments.
